POSITION SUMMARY
The PEO Sales Consultant will play a crucial role in expanding our client base by supporting their external sales partner in promoting and selling our PEO MEP and PEP services to PEOs and their retirement plan advisors. This role includes proactive outreach, attending key industry events, and building strong relationships with PEO contacts and prospects.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
- Partner with the assigned external VP of PEO Sales in promoting and selling our PEO MEP and PEP services by taking part in finals presentations, providing technology demos and other tasks necessary to bring in new PEO business
- Attend all major NAPEO and other PEO industry events throughout the year and continue to deepen relationships with current PEO contacts, industry contacts and PEO prospects.
- Proactive outbound sales calls and appointment setting
- Prepare customized proposals outlining the scope of Slavic401k services, pricing structures and terms
- Assist with sales presentations and web demonstrations that highlight the features and benefits of our Slavic401k services
- Cultivate strong, long-term relationships with advisors and industry partners
- Meet the specified weekly activity metrics and goals
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of sales activities in Salesforce
- Assist in completing the sale process by proactively reaching out for required onboarding information
- Be the main point of contact for startup PEOs in their first year to drive adoption
- Assist with plan onboarding and enrollment meetings when applicable

What’s in it for you Package
This role will have a base pay range of $90,000 - $100,000. Please know, this is the base range only and does not consider other components that make up the total rewards package for this role. This position is also eligible for sales commission and tiered bonus, both based on achievement of sales goals.
Other perks in the total rewards package are:
• Flexible work environment
• Participation in Personal Annual Performance Bonus incentive program
• Medical, Dental, Vision, and Life Insurance
• 75% employer coverage of Medical Premiums
• Retirement Savings – 401(k) plan with generous company match, vested after 2 years
• Tuition Reimbursement up to $5,250/year
• Generous Paid Time Off upon hire – plus quarterly Work/Life Balance days and paid holidays
• Paid Parental Leave
• Voluntary Pet Insurance, Lifelock and More!
• 24/7 no-cost Employee Assistance Program (EAP)
